Chapter 274: Chapter 175: You Are Yang Qi?

"Teacher Liu, please don’t go to any special trouble for me."

Yang Qi politely declined. "This is my first time at Yongcheng Zoo. I’d like to just walk around, take a look at your enclosure designs and the animals’ condition, and learn a thing or two. If you have time and it’s convenient, you can just be my guide. If you’re busy, don’t worry about me."

"I’m not busy, not at all."

Xiaoliu said quickly, "Expert Yang, you’re too kind. Just call me Xiaoliu. It’s my honor to be your guide. Our zoo has its own unique features. I’ll show you around right now!"

And so, with Xiaoliu as his enthusiastic guide, Yang Qi spent the morning touring a large portion of Yongcheng Zoo.

Yongcheng Zoo was built by the sea, and some of its exhibits had a distinct oceanic flair. It also boasted a wide variety of animals, and the management seemed well-organized.

Yang Qi found it all fascinating, occasionally discussing ideas about animal husbandry and enrichment with Xiaoliu, who learned a great deal from the exchange.

When noon came, Xiaoliu took Yang Qi to the zoo’s staff cafeteria to try the employee meals. The food wasn’t half bad.

After the meal, Xiaoliu escorted Yang Qi to the on-site guesthouse used for hosting visiting experts.

The room was clean and tidy, and fully equipped.

Yang Qi thanked Xiaoliu and closed the door. He first sent messages to Jiang Kai and Mei Ying at Donghua Zoo, briefly reporting that the initial cause of "Dawei’s" situation had been determined and that he was coordinating a solution.

Then, he sat cross-legged on the floor and took a Qi Condensing Pill to recover the Magical Power he had expended that morning. As he did, he mentally ran through the possible upcoming scenarios and planned his responses.

...

Around 3:00 PM, the landline in the room started ringing.

Yang Qi picked it up. It was Lu Gangsheng.

"Expert Yang, did you get some rest?"

Lu Gangsheng’s voice sounded a bit tired, but it also carried a trace of relief, as if a great weight had been lifted.

"Just fine, Director Lu. Do you have an update?" Yang Qi asked, sensing the difference in his tone.

"We got the cubs back!"

Lu Gangsheng said, "Nanling Zoo agreed to our request for an emergency negotiation. They’ve temporarily suspended the exchange agreement and are transporting the two cubs back. The transport vehicle is already on the road and should arrive by evening."

"That fast?"

Yang Qi was surprised. That was far more efficient than he’d expected. "Director Lu, that’s incredible! I can’t believe you pulled it off!"

On the other end of the line, however, Lu Gangsheng gave a wry laugh, his tone turning conflicted.

"Expert Yang, don’t praise me just yet. The cubs are coming back, but they’re bringing trouble with them."

"Oh? What kind of trouble?" Yang Qi asked.

"Vice Director Yu Xiulian from Nanling Zoo, the one in charge of the exchange, is personally leading the team. She’s coming along with the transport truck!"

Lu Gangsheng sighed. "Vice Director Yu is a well-known expert in our field. Her personality... well, she’s a stickler for details. She doesn’t understand our sudden request to halt the exchange and bring the cubs back. In fact, she’s rather indignant about it."

"She said on the phone that she’s coming to see for herself just what sort of ’monumental crisis’ we’re having that would make us demand the return of animals we’ve already traded. And what’s more..."

He paused and lowered his voice. "And she explicitly stated that she wants to meet you—the ’Expert Yang’ who ’supposedly’ can talk to tigers and pinpointed the root of the problem."

"She said if it turns out ’Dawei’s’ problem isn’t what you claim, or if your ’treatment’ is ineffective and the cubs were hauled all the way back for nothing, she... she won’t let it go. She’ll probably make some noise about it in the industry."

The implication was clear: Vice Director Yu of Nanling Zoo was coming to hold them accountable and conduct an on-site verification.

If Yang Qi succeeded, it would be a win for everyone.

But if he failed, both Yang Qi and Yongcheng Zoo would likely face criticism and pressure.

"Rest assured, Director Lu."

Yang Qi’s voice was calm as he replied, "As long as the cubs get back safely and ’Dawei’ sees them, I can practically guarantee his problem will be solved."

"As for Vice Director Yu... if she wants to watch, let her. Actions speak louder than words."

Hearing Yang Qi’s confident reply, Lu Gangsheng’s anxiety eased a little. "I hope so. Expert Yang, we’re counting on you. When the cubs arrive this evening, after we get them settled, we’ll arrange for ’Dawei’ to meet them. Vice Director Yu and her team will also be present."

"Okay, no problem," Yang Qi replied.

...

The cubs returned even faster than expected.

Shortly before 5:00 PM, a professional animal transport vehicle marked with the Nanling Zoo logo slowly drove into Yongcheng Zoo, heading directly for the service road near the large carnivore area.

After receiving a message from Lu Gangsheng, Yang Qi immediately hurried over from the guesthouse.

A crowd had already gathered by the transport vehicle. Besides Lu Gangsheng and several staff members and Veterinarians from Yongcheng Zoo, there were a few unfamiliar faces, who must have been the people from Nanling Zoo who came with the truck.

Leading them was a sharp, competent-looking middle-aged woman who appeared to be in her fifties.

She had a neat, ear-length bob, stood around five feet seven inches tall, and had a ramrod-straight posture.

At the moment, her brow was slightly furrowed as she sized up the two special transport cages being unloaded from the truck.

Inside the cages, two small Northeast Tigers, about three or four months old with bright fur and round heads, were whimpering uneasily and pawing at the cage walls.

Lu Gangsheng was talking to this woman when he saw Yang Qi approaching and quickly waved him over.

"Expert Yang, over here!"

Hearing this, the short-haired woman immediately turned her head and locked her eyes on the approaching Yang Qi.

She looked him up and down, her gaze lingering for a moment on his overly young face, and her brow seemed to furrow even more tightly.

As Yang Qi approached, she questioned him directly.

"So you’re the ’Expert Yang’ who declared that the male tiger, ’Dawei’, was refusing to eat because he wanted to see his cubs?"

She put a slight emphasis on the two words "Expert Yang," her eyes full of scrutiny, as if trying to find some flaw in the young man’s face.

A man in his early thirties standing beside her, wearing glasses and a Nanling Zoo uniform, caught sight of Yang Qi.

Seeing a face so much younger—and frankly, far more handsome—than his own, a look of undisguised shock and jealousy flashed across his features, and he couldn’t stop himself from muttering under his breath.

His voice wasn’t loud, but everyone present heard it clearly.

"What the hell... Can just anyone call themselves an ’expert’ these days? Director Lu must be desperate, clutching at straws."
